Inland Definition, Usage & Common Phrases (2 meaning)
Meaning 1:interior region (inland)
inland
/ˈɪnlənd/
adj.
Located away from the coast, in the middle part of a country.

📖 Root Explanation
From 'in' meaning 'inside' and 'land' meaning 'earth or territory', thus 'within the land'.

🔗 Collocations
inland sea – A large body of salt water completely surrounded by land.
inland navigation – The practice of traveling on rivers and lakes within a country.
inland revenue – Government department responsible for collecting taxes from domestic sources.

📖 Cultural Story
Inland originates from Old English 'inland', combining 'in' (inside) and 'land' (land). It has been used since the 9th century to describe areas away from the coast, reflecting early geographical distinctions in settlement patterns.
